How to Maximize Your Study Manual
Simply owning a high-quality study manual isn’t enough; it’s how you use it that matters. Here are some actionable strategies to get the most out of your resource:
1. Set a Study Schedule: Map out your preparation timeline, dedicating regular blocks of time each week to review material and tackle practice questions.
2. Focus on Weak Areas: Use diagnostic quizzes and self-assessments to identify and prioritize topics where you need the most improvement.
3. Simulate Exam Conditions: Take full-length practice exams under timed conditions to get comfortable with the pacing and pressure of the real test.
4. Review Mistakes Thoroughly: Analyze incorrect answers to understand your mistakes and avoid repeating them.
5. Utilize Supplementary Resources: Pair your manual with online videos, discussion forums, and study groups for a well-rounded preparation experience.
